The main purpose of this paper are:1)To clarify the research achievements about Chinese Buddhist-Christian dialogue on the period of the Republic of China;2)Put the Buddhist-Christian dialogue of Buddhism and Christian into one text other than put them into different texts.3)To interpreted the influences of modernity to Chinese Buddhist-Christian dialogue.4)To use the examples of the period of the Republic of China to discovered the straits and possibilities of Chinese Buddhist-Christian dialogue, especially in the background of modernity.5)To establish cross-religious religion-dialogue model. The main research methods are documents analyses, historical analyses and comparative analyses.The chapter 2 began from Christianity, to analyze the Chinese Christianity in the background of modernity. The main arguments are Chinese Christianity’s debates with scientism. Then through some representatives to analyze the three dialogue models in Christianity. Eventually ends of Chinese Christianity use reference of Buddhism. The chapter 3 I talked about Buddhism and the structure are similar to Chapter 2.Oneness-model was the main model of Buddhist-Christianity dialogue by Chinese Buddhism on the period of the Republic of China. Moreover, because west culture took modernity idea and Buddhism learn in many ways from Christianity as one of the representatives of west culture. The chapter 4 based on the messages of historical analysis, to clarify the differences and identical of Chinese Buddhist-Christianity. Especially establish a platform from latter conclusion. The chapter 5 analyze weather the contemporary interreligious dialogue model can summarized the model of Chinese Buddhist-Christianity in the period of Republic of China. And try to co-relate the results to the dialogue model that I established.Thus Chinese Buddhism has not similar dialogue model to Chinese Christianity in the period of the Republic of China. As Chinese Buddhists must deal with the problem of modernity more urgency than Chinese Christian at same time, and Christianity that from modern west into pluralism more easily than Buddhism.
